1, 5, 25,  125

This is a geometric sequence since there is a common ratio between each term. In this case, multiplying the previous term in the sequence by

5 gives the next term. In other words,  an=a1⋅rn−1. Geometric Sequence: r=5

This is the form of a geometric sequence.an=a1rn−1 Substitute in the values of a1=1 and r=5.an=(1)⋅(5)n−1 Multiply (5)n−1 by 1. an=5n−1
